Accepted proposals for Semester S26A
The Call for Proposals for Semester S26A received 157 submitted proposals for the Normal and Intensive Programs requesting a total of 444.92 nights.
After screening by TAC, 93.13 (including 11ToO) nights were allocated to the following 58 proposals.
In addition, 14.0 nights are assigned to PFS SSP project, 3.5 nights are assigned to Service Program observations and 14.8 nights are assigned to four on-going Intensive Programs: S24A-023 (6.0 nights), S24B-080 (2.3 Queue (3.3) nights), S25A-047 (3.15 Queue (4.5) nights) and S25B-065 (1.0 night).
